Hi Dougy. Ullwell cottage is a lovely site, make sure if you go to ask for hardstanding pitch though.

Their indoor pool plus Pub and restaurant are first class.

There is also lots to do in the area and you will not be disappointed.

Only down side is that the site is very expensive which is the only reason we stopped using it.
